ホームページ >ウェブフロントエンド >CSSチュートリアル >iOS のパン中に固定位置の要素が誤動作するのはなぜですか?

iOS のパン中に固定位置の要素が誤動作するのはなぜですか?

Patricia Arquette
Patricia Arquetteオリジナル
2024-12-16 07:10:12139ブラウズ

Why Do Fixed-Positioned Elements Misbehave During iOS Panning?

iOS デバイスでの位置の問題を修正しました

質問:

iScroll とSencha ライブラリ、iOS 上のモバイル Safari でパン中に固定位置の要素が更新できないのはなぜですか

答え:

固定要素が小さい画面でのブラウジングを妨げる可能性があるため、モバイル ブラウザでは「position:fixed」をサポートしないことがよくあります。

技術的な説明:

Quirksmode.org は、この問題の洞察に富んだ分析: http://www.quirksmode.org/blog/archives/2010/12/the_fifth_posit.html

さらに、互換性チャートは http://www.quirksmode で入手できます。 org/m/css.html

iOS および Androidアップデート:

iOS 5 と Android 4 は「position:fixed」をサポートするようになったと報告されています。

個人テスト:

作者は機能することを確認しましたiOS 5 では「position:fixed」ですが、固定の前後でズームとパンの制限が発生する可能性があります

更新された互換性テーブル:

http://caniuse.com/#search=fixed は、Android、Opera、iOS のリアルタイムの互換性データを提供します。

以上がiOS のパン中に固定位置の要素が誤動作するのはなぜです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。